dc.description.abstractThis is a portrait of Winton "Red" Blount from Montgomery, Alabama who was appointed to the Board of Trustees in 1977. He served as U. S. Postmaster General from 1960 to 1970 and in 1968 he was the president of the Chamber of Commerce of the United States. Blount Auditorium in Buckman Hall on the Rhodes College Campus is named in his honor.en_US
